    Just a heads up for everyone regarding Skype. I use iSkoot on my Palm Treo 650 right now which basically uses wireless web to log onto Skype to grab Contacts. But when you make a call, it doesn't go through the web but rather dials a local access number so it doesn't stream, just uses your airtime. If you have unlimited evenings and weekends, it's a great way to make free calls to Skype users and cheap long distance calls (I paid $30 for a years worth of unlimited North American calling). Seems there's a Windows Mobile version so I can definitely use that when I get my HTC S720. It doesn't cost anything, I assume they receive commission from Skype...
